Abstract
The invention provides a buoyancy tank type deepwater pile group bridge abutment construction platform and a construction method of the construction platform. The buoyancy tank type deepwater pile group bridge abutment construction platform comprises a buoyancy tank type construction platform body prefabricated according to the size of a bridge abutment and the size of pile positions, and a working platform is erected on the upper portion of the buoyancy tank type construction platform body. The buoyancy tank type construction platform body is positioned through an anchorage device. Pile holes for pile driving are preformed in the bottom face of the buoyancy tank type construction platform body, and casing pipes for pile body steel tubes to penetrate through are arranged on the pile holes and connected with the edges of the pile holes in a sealing mode. Rubber water sealing rings capable of being inflated with high pressure gas or being infused with high pressure water are arranged at the joints of the outer walls of the pile body steel tubes and the bottom portions of the corresponding pile holes. The invention further provides the construction method of the buoyancy tank type deepwater pile group bridge abutment construction platform. The buoyancy tank type deepwater pile group bridge abutment construction platform is not only used as a bridge abutment die, but also used as a platform for pile foundation operation at sea, and therefore construction difficulty is lowered, the job progress is quickened, a large number of artificial materials are saved, equipment input is reduced, and full-water-surface operation which saves time, guarantees the quality, and is efficient and safe is achieved for the buoyancy tank type construction platform.

Technical field
The present invention relates to pile foundation in deep water abutment technical field of construction, particularly relate to a kind of floating box type deep water clump of piles abutment operation platform and construction method thereof of full water surface operation.
Background technology
Along with the develop rapidly that Bridges in Our Country is built, bridge Construction Technology has also obtained new breakthrough.Some large-scale over strait, across the height of its design standard of Jiang Qiaoliang and technology content, the complexity of technology and execution conditions, is representing the highest level of current bridge construction.And the Focal point and difficult point of bridge construction is just pile foundation in deep water and abutment construction.
The general flow of existing deep water clump of piles abutment construction technology is: inserted to play special-purpose steel pile tube → set up Pile Installation Platform → sinking steel casing → drilled pile construction → operation platform dismounting → box to transfer in place → box back cover, the concreting of draw water → cushion cap.
This construction technology not only difficulty of construction is large, and programming is slow, also causes a large amount of artificial material wastes, and equipment investment amount is large; Steel box is installed difficulty, and easily causes security incident.

Detailed description of the invention
Below in conjunction with drawings and Examples, the invention will be further described.
With reference to Fig. 1 ~ Fig. 3, a kind of floating box type deep water clump of piles abutment operation platform that the present embodiment provides, comprise floating box type operation platform 1, floating box type operation platform 1 is gone along with sb. to guard him punching block 11 and bottom surface by side and is gone along with sb. to guard him punching block 12 and surround, and is provided with Mi Shui band between all connecting sewings of going along with sb. to guard him punching block; The top of floating box type operation platform 1 is erected with working platform 2, and working platform 2 is provided with the platform preformed hole corresponding with all piles hole 13, can make pile body steel pipe 15 by platform preformed hole when piling; The middle part of floating box type operation platform 1 is provided with support 18, supports floating box type operation platform 1 for connecting, and not only guarantees that deformation does not occur floating box type operation platform 1, also needs to meet the requirement of pile driving equipment operation on working platform 2.Side is gone along with sb. to guard him the both sides of punching block 11 and is extended anchor cable 20, and the lower end of anchor cable 20 is connected with anchor shank 21, and anchor cable 20 and anchor shank 21 are referred to as ground tackle, and floating box type operation platform 1 is located by ground tackle; The bottom surface of floating box type operation platform 1 is preset with the stake hole 13 for driving piles, and stake hole 13 is provided with for the sleeve pipe 14 through pile body steel pipe 15, and sleeve pipe 14 is connected with stake hole 13 edge seals; The outer wall of pile body steel pipe 15 is provided with the close hydrosphere 16 of rubber with the junction, bottom in stake hole 13; The periphery in stake hole 13 is provided with connector 17; The outer upper part of floating box type operation platform 1 is provided with water pocket (not shown), and for counterweight, the bottom of floating box type operation platform 1 is provided with air cushion 19(with reference to Fig. 6).
The diameter of sleeve pipe 14 is greater than pile body steel pipe 15 diameter 6 ~ 10cm, and the height of sleeve pipe 14 exceedes the underwater penetration of floating box type operation platform 1.Because pile body steel pipe 15 is through in sleeve pipe 14, while being driven underground with weight, pile body steel pipe 15 has slightly and rocks, and by the impact that floating box type operation platform 1 is not rocked by pile body steel pipe 15 when guaranteeing to drive piles of reserved sleeve pipe 14 spaces, improves stability.The material of sleeve pipe 14 is rubber, and elasticity is large, not yielding.
With reference to Fig. 4, the design principle of the close hydrosphere 16 of rubber is with air tube or lifebuoy, one side of the close hydrosphere 16 of rubber is provided with inflation inlet 161, when being inwardly filled with high pressure gas or injecting water under high pressure, expand, space between the inwall of sleeve pipe 14 and pile body steel pipe 15 outer walls is filled up, after good seal, removed sleeve pipe 14 and be positioned at the above part in bottom surface of floating box type operation platform 1, avoid water to infiltrate floating box type operation platform 1, be convenient to connector 17 and be welded and fixed with pile body steel pipe 15 outer walls.
With reference to Fig. 5, the edge surrounding of connector 17 is provided with 8 fixing holes 173, fixes, to back out nut 172 complete man-hour by screw rod 171 and nut 172 with the bottom surface of floating box type operation platform 1, withdraw the bottom surface of floating box type operation platform 1, for the recycling of next engineering; Pile body steel pipe 15, by welding with the centre bore edge 174 of connector 17, is fixed on floating box type operation platform 1 on pile body steel pipe 15 walls by design elevation.
With reference to Fig. 6, air cushion 19 is provided with the air cushion preformed hole 191 corresponding with all piles hole 13, can make pile body steel pipe 15 by air cushion preformed hole 191 when piling; One side of air cushion 19 is provided with three air inlet ports 192 for inflating.In the time that floating box type operation platform 1 underwater penetration is less than design elevation, can be by ground tackle in conjunction with the underwater penetration of the drop-down adjusting floating box type of water pocket operation platform 1 to reach design elevation; In the time that floating box type operation platform 1 underwater penetration exceedes design elevation, (as added main equipment construction etc. on ebb or working platform), can stablize floating box type operation platform 1 by air cushion 19.
The construction method of the present embodiment comprises the following steps:
(1) floating box type operation platform 1 factory press abutment and stake position size prefabricated after, bank all splicing good after, floating traction to design attitude construct and fixed;
(2) utilize ground tackle location floating box type operation platform 1, utilize water pocket and air cushion 19 to regulate the underwater penetration of floating box type operation platform 1;
(3) floating box type operation platform 1 top be erected with working platform 2, the plant equipment of piling is positioned on working platform 2 and (utilizes water pocket and air cushion 19 balance floating box type operation platform 1 again);
(4) pile body steel pipe 15 is squeezed into riverbed through sleeve pipe 14, after rig pore-forming, put into the inner chamber of pile body steel pipe 15 reinforcing cage that colligation is good, then concrete perfusion is to design elevation (laitance cuts highly and takes into account);
(5) after all or part of pile foundation operation completes, again check the location of proofreading and correct floating box type operation platform 1, then open the close hydrosphere 16 of rubber, be inwardly filled with high pressure gas or inject water under high pressure; After close water is intact, remove sleeve pipe 14 and be positioned at the above part in bottom surface of floating box type operation platform 1; Connector 17 and pile body steel pipe 15 outer walls are welded and fixed; Slice off pile body steel pipe 15 and be positioned at redundance more than floating box type operation platform 1 bottom surface;
(6) cutter pile crown, cleaning floating box type operation platform 1 bottom surface, colligation abutment reinforcing bar, perfusion abutment concrete;
(7) reach after requirement until the concrete intensity of abutment, the side of withdrawing successively floating box type operation platform 1 goes along with sb. to guard him punching block 11 and punching block 12 is gone along with sb. to guard him in bottom surface, completes a whole set of operation, and the floating box type operation platform 1 of withdrawing is convenient to recycling after clearing up maintenance.
